Data Science Jobs Guide: Resources for a Career in Tech
Data science is a rapidly growing field involving statistical and computational techniques to extract insights and knowledge from data.
It is critical in many industries, including technology, finance, healthcare, and more.
Resources for a Career in Data Science
Here are some resources to help you get started on your career path in data science:
- Online Courses and Degrees: Many online courses and degree programs can help you learn the skills you need to become a data scientist. Some popular options include Coursera, edX, and Udacity.
- Professional Certificates: Earning a professional certificate in data science can be a great way to demonstrate your expertise and boost your resume. Some popular options include the Data Science Certificate from Johns Hopkins University and the Data Science Certificate from HarvardX.
- Books: Reading books on data science can be a great way to learn about the field and stay up-to-date on the latest developments. Some popular books include "Data Science from Scratch" by Joel Grus and "Doing Data Science" by Cathy O'Neil and Rachel Schutt.
- Conferences and Meetups: Attending conferences and meetups can be a great way to network with other professionals in the field and learn about new developments and job opportunities. Some popular conferences include the ACM SIGKDD Conference on Knowledge Discovery and Data Mining and the Strata Data Conference.
- Professional Organisations: Joining a professional organisation like the Data Science Association or the International Association for Statistical Computing can be a great way to connect with other professionals in the field and stay up-to-date on the latest developments.
Career paths in data science
Many career paths in data science are available, depending on your interests and skills. Some typical roles in data science include:
- Data Scientist: Data scientists use statistical and computational techniques to extract insights and knowledge from data. They may work on tasks such as developing machine learning models, analysing large datasets, or building data visualisation tools.
- Data Engineer: Data engineers are responsible for building the infrastructure and pipelines that enable organisations to store, process, and analyse data. They may work on tasks such as designing and implementing data storage systems, building pipelines, or optimising data processing performance.
- Business Intelligence (BI) Analyst: BI analysts use data to help organisations make better business decisions. They may work on tasks such as developing dashboards and reports, analysing data to identify trends and patterns, or providing recommendations to decision-makers.
- Machine Learning Engineer: Machine learning engineers build and deploy machine learning models in production environments. They may work on tasks such as designing and implementing machine learning pipelines, optimising model performance, or integrating machine learning models into applications.
- Data Analyst: Data analysts work with data to help organisations make informed decisions. They may work on tasks such as collecting and cleaning data, analysing data to identify trends and patterns or creating visualisations to communicate findings to stakeholders.
- Data Visualization Designer: Data visualisation designers create visual representations of data to help organisations understand and communicate information. They may work on tasks such as designing charts, graphs, and maps or creating interactive data visualisations.
These are just a few examples of the many career paths available in data science. Ultimately, the best approach for you will depend on your interests, skills, and the specific needs of the organisations you work for.
Skills and tools required
To be successful in a career in data science, you should consider learning the following skills:
- Programming: Data scientists often work with large datasets, and being proficient in a programming language like Python or R can be essential for tasks such as data manipulation, visualisation, and machine learning.
- Statistics: Data scientists use statistical techniques to extract insights from data, so a strong understanding of statistical concepts and methods is essential.
- Machine Learning: Machine learning involves using algorithms to learn patterns in data and make predictions automatically. Familiarity with machine learning techniques and frameworks is essential for many data science roles.
- Data Visualization: Effectively communicating findings through visualisations is essential for data scientists. Tools like Tableau, Matplotlib, and Seaborn can help create charts, graphs, and maps.
- Data Wrangling: Data often comes in messy or unstructured forms, and cleaning and transforming data is an essential skill for data scientists. Tools like Pandas and SQL can be helpful in data-wrangling tasks.
- Data Storage and Processing: Data scientists often work with large datasets that need to be stored and processed efficiently. Familiarity with technologies like Hadoop and Spark can help work with big data.
In addition to these skills, data scientists should also have strong problem-solving, communication, and collaboration skills, as they often work on teams and must be able to communicate their findings to a wide range of stakeholders effectively.
Degrees and certificates to earn
There are a variety of degrees and certificates that can help you pursue a career in data science. Some popular options include:
- Bachelor's Degree: A bachelor's degree in a field such as a computer science, statistics, or mathematics can provide a strong foundation for a career in data science. Many universities offer programs specifically focused on data science or related fields.
- Master's Degree: A master's degree in data science, machine learning, or statistics can provide more advanced training in these areas and help pursue more advanced roles in data science.
- Professional Certificate: Professional certificates in data science can be a good option for those who want to gain specific skills or demonstrate their expertise in the field without committing to a full degree program. Some popular options include the Data Science Certificate from Johns Hopkins University and the Data Science Certificate from HarvardX.
Ultimately, the best degree or certificate for you will depend on your goals and the specific requirements of the organisations you hope to work for.
It's always a good idea to research the specific skills and knowledge most in demand in the job market and tailor your education accordingly.
Fun ways to learn and build your skills in Data Science
There are many ways to learn and develop your skills in data science that can be both enjoyable and effective. Here are a few ideas:
- Participate in online challenges and hackathons: Online challenges and hackathons can be a fun way to learn new skills and apply them in a real-world context. Many websites, such as Kaggle and Hackerrank, offer a range of data science challenges and hackathons in which you can participate.
- Join a data science community: Joining a community of like-minded individuals can be a great way to learn from others and stay up-to-date on the latest developments in the field. There are many online communities, such as Reddit's r/data science and Kaggle's forums, where you can connect with other data science enthusiasts and learn from one another.
- Work on a personal project: It can be a great way to learn new skills and apply them meaningfully. You can choose a project that aligns with your interests and goals and use it as an opportunity to learn new techniques and tools.
- Attend meetups and conferences: Attending demonstrations and meetings can be a great way to learn from experts in the field and stay up-to-date on the latest developments. Many cities have data science meetups that you can join and a wide range of conferences you can attend.
- Take online courses: Many online courses can help you learn new skills and advance your career in data science. Some popular options include Coursera, edX, and Udacity.
By incorporating some of these activities into your learning plan, you can build your skills enjoyably and effectively.